TOLB (The Other Little Board) is a replacement for the MOS 8701 clock generator chip used on boards 250425, 250466, 250469 and the C128. Works on the C64 Reloaded too!
Main features:
- PAL version
- Gold plated pins
- Onboard oscillator makes it independent from the C64 crystal and easy to convert a C64 from NTSC to PAL
- Consumes only 9 mA of power (a genuine MOS 8701 consumes 25-30 mA)
